一个项目有多少人参与?基于修订控制系统
您如何知道有多少开发人员参与了使用修订控制系统的项目?我的一个朋友在 git log 中查找答案时发现了这种方法: git log | grep Author: | sort -u |…
Windows 上的 Python 性能
Python 在 Windows 上通常比 *nix 机器上慢吗? Python 似乎在我的 Mac OS X 机器上运行得很好,而在我的 Windows Vista 机器上似乎运行得更慢。这些…
配置hudson构建多个分支
我使用ant文件通过hudson在mercurial中构建一个java项目。 mailnine 有一个 hudson 工作运行得很好。 最近创建了一个新分支并通过命令行推送到服务器…
使用 Mercurial 作为智能本地缓存进行颠覆时维护一个月的历史记录
这里和这里也有类似的问题,但是它们并不相同,因为它们是询问一般意义上如何将 Mercurial 和 subversion 一起使用。 仔细阅读 Mercurial 和 Subversi…
如何将变更集从 hg 存储库导出到 svn 存储库
我知道 Mercurial 有 hgsubversion 扩展。但在我知道它是如何工作之前,我维护了两个独立的存储库,一个是 SVN repo,一个是 Hg repo。我最近在 Hg 存…
如何纠正损坏的 $PYTHONPATH?
在我的 Ubuntu 9.10 Linux Box 中重新启动后尝试启动 Mercurial(hg) 时,我收到以下消息: abort: couldn't find mercurial libraries in [/usr/bin /…
每次在生产服务器上更新 Mercurial 分支时是否都必须合并并提交?
我在最近的一个项目中使用了 Mercurial。在我部署项目的网络服务器上,我的配置文件与生产设置略有不同。问题是当我拉动和更新时,我经常还必须合并和…
Mercurial:维护 Visual studio 2005 和 2008 分支
我正在尝试开发一种工作流程,使我们能够维护单独的 Visual studio 2005 和 2008 版本的库,同时确保对一个分支的更改始终复制到另一个分支中。 目前…
在 Linux 上运行 hg Convert
我想将远程 Perforce 存储库转换为 Linux 上的 Mercurial 存储库。 所以我在 Linux 机器上安装了 Python 和 Mercurial。 然后我测试了一些 hg(Mercur…
Mercurial 和 Git 中 JSLint 的预提交挂钩
我想在提交到 Mercurial 或 Git 存储库之前运行 JSLint。 我希望这是一个自动设置的步骤,而不是依赖开发人员(主要是我)记住事先运行 JSLint。我通…
如何在 Mercurial 中维护客户之间的多条开发线?
我致力于为多个客户维护相同的电子商务网络应用程序。 最初有一组标准页面,过去所有其他客户定制都是从中派生的。 最近我工作的地方决定使用Mercuria…
Windows 中的 Mercurial 看不到 .hgignore - 为什么?
Windows 无法获取我的 .hgignore 文件。我从命令行运行 Mercurial,“hg status”显示被忽略的目录中的大量文件。 .hgignore 文件如下所示(文件开头…
Mercurial 克隆问题
我正在使用 Mercurial,并且已在本地克隆了一个存储库,并且在 hg Push 上,我得到了以下信息: abort: cannot lock static-http repository 这是什么…